The impact of SharePoint on task management in academic research and scientific studies
06/09/2023

Academic research and scientific studies often involve complex tasks and collaboration among multiple team members. Efficient task management is crucial for ensuring timely completion of projects and achieving research objectives. SharePoint, as a powerful collaboration and document management platform, offers a wide range of features and tools that can significantly impact task management in academic research and scientific studies.

SharePoint for Project Collaboration

One of the key benefits of SharePoint is its ability to facilitate project collaboration. With SharePoint, researchers and scientists can create project sites that serve as centralized hubs for all project-related information, tasks, and documents. These project sites can be easily customized to fit the specific needs of each research project, allowing team members to collaborate effectively.

SharePoint project sites offer features such as discussion boards, task lists, calendars, and document libraries. These tools enable team members to communicate, assign tasks, track progress, and share important documents in a single, secure location. The ability to collaborate in real-time and have a centralized repository of project-related information greatly enhances task management in academic research and scientific studies.

SharePoint for Document Management

Effective document management is essential for academic research and scientific studies. SharePoint provides robust document management capabilities that streamline the process of creating, organizing, and sharing documents.

With SharePoint, researchers can create document libraries where they can store and organize research papers, articles, datasets, and other relevant documents. These document libraries can be easily accessed by team members, ensuring everyone has the latest version of the documents they need. SharePoint also allows for version control, making it easy to track changes and revert to previous versions if needed.

Additionally, SharePoint offers powerful search capabilities, making it effortless to find specific documents or information within a large repository. This saves researchers valuable time and effort that would otherwise be spent searching for documents manually.

SharePoint for Task Management

Task management is a critical aspect of academic research and scientific studies. SharePoint provides several features and tools that enhance task management and help researchers stay organized and on track.

SharePoint task lists allow researchers to create and assign tasks to team members, set due dates, and track progress. Task owners receive notifications and reminders, ensuring tasks are completed in a timely manner. The ability to view and update tasks in real-time promotes transparency and accountability within the research team.

Furthermore, SharePoint offers integration with Outlook, allowing researchers to sync tasks between SharePoint and their personal calendars. This ensures that tasks and deadlines are synchronized across platforms, preventing any miscommunication or missed deadlines.

SharePoint Forms and Workflows

SharePoint forms and workflows provide additional support for task management in academic research and scientific studies. Researchers can create custom forms to collect data, feedback, or responses from team members or study participants. These forms can be easily designed using SharePoint's intuitive interface, eliminating the need for complex coding or development.

Once the forms are created, SharePoint workflows can be implemented to automate processes and streamline task management. Workflows can be used to route forms for approval, trigger notifications, or initiate specific actions based on predefined conditions. This automation reduces manual effort and ensures that tasks are carried out consistently and efficiently.
